Strategic Placement: Where to Ink Your Small Tattoo

Choosing the right placement is just as important as selecting the design itself. The location of your small tattoo can impact its visibility, its aesthetic appeal, and even the tattooing experience itself.

Wrist

The wrist is a popular choice for small tattoos, offering a visible yet relatively discreet location. It’s a great spot for minimalist symbols, lettering, or small floral designs. However, keep in mind that the skin on the wrist is thin, so the tattooing process may be slightly more sensitive.

Ankle

The ankle is another popular location for small tattoos, particularly among women. It’s a subtle and feminine spot that can be easily concealed or shown off depending on your footwear. Small floral designs, animal motifs, or geometric patterns work well on the ankle. [See also: Ankle Tattoo Pain: What to Expect]

Behind the Ear

A small tattoo behind the ear is a discreet and stylish choice. It’s a great spot for small symbols, musical notes, or tiny animal designs. The placement is subtle yet eye-catching, making it a unique and personal statement.

Fingers

Finger tattoos are becoming increasingly popular, but they require careful consideration. The skin on the fingers is prone to fading, so it’s important to choose a simple design and work with an experienced artist. Small symbols, initials, or minimalist patterns work best on the fingers.

Collarbone

The collarbone is an elegant and sensual location for a small tattoo. It’s a great spot for delicate floral designs, lettering, or celestial motifs. The placement is visible yet sophisticated, adding a touch of allure to your appearance.

Ensuring Longevity: Caring for Your Small Tattoo

Proper aftercare is crucial for ensuring the longevity and vibrancy of your small tattoo. Follow your artist’s instructions carefully and keep the tattooed area clean and moisturized. Avoid excessive sun exposure, as it can cause the ink to fade over time. With proper care, your small tattoo can remain a beautiful and meaningful piece of art for years to come.

Choosing the Right Artist for Your Small Tattoo Design Ideas

Selecting a skilled and experienced tattoo artist is paramount, especially when it comes to small tattoo design ideas. Intricate details require a steady hand and a keen eye. Look for an artist who specializes in fine-line work and has a portfolio showcasing their expertise in small tattoos. Read reviews, check their credentials, and schedule a consultation to discuss your design and placement preferences. A reputable artist will prioritize your safety and ensure that your tattoo is executed with precision and care.
